Boxer Ramla Ali: From Olympic Rings to Film Sets
Sunday, December 8, 2024
The boxer-turned-actress found the filmmaking process surprisingly parallel to her athletic career. Both require immense dedication and hard work, which Ali had abundantly due to her rigorous training as a professional athlete.
786 Entertainment, backed by Saudi Prince Faisal Al Saud and the Vainqueur Family Group, aims to promote local talent in Saudi Arabia. The company will have its headquarters in London but plans to open a production office in Jeddah to support local filmmakers.
Moore, Ali's husband and former coach, expressed his surprise at how much she enjoyed the filmmaking process. "Making films is quite tough, " he admitted, but Ali's athletic discipline made the transition smooth.
